Description
This moist and flavorful Pumpkin Bread recipe is perfect for fall and holiday seasons. Made with canned pumpkin puree and warm spices like cinnamon, nutmeg, and ginger, it combines the perfect balance of sweetness and spice. Ideal for breakfast, snacks, or a comforting dessert, this bread is easy to prepare and delivers a tender crumb with a deliciously aromatic taste.
Ingredients
Scale
Wet Ingredients
- 1 cup canned pumpkin puree
- 1/2 cup granulated sugar
- 1/2 cup packed brown sugar
- 1/2 cup vegetable oil
- 2 large eggs
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
Dry Ingredients
- 1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
- 1 teaspoon baking powder
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- 1/2 teaspoon ground nutmeg
- 1/4 teaspoon ground ginger
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
Instructions
- Preheat and Prepare Pan: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a 9×5 inch loaf pan to prevent the bread from sticking during baking.
- Mix Wet Ingredients: In a large mixing bowl, combine the canned pumpkin puree, granulated sugar, brown sugar, vegetable oil, eggs, and vanilla extract. Whisk thoroughly until the mixture is smooth and well blended.
- Combine Dry Ingredients: In a separate medium b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, baking soda, baking powder, ground cinnamon, ground nutmeg, ground ginger, and salt to ensure even distribution of the leavening agents and spices.
- Combine Wet and Dry: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ients. Stir gently with a rubber spatula until just combined, making sure not to overmix as this could make the bread tough.
- Pour Batter and Smooth: Pour the batter into the prepared loaf pan, smoothing the surface with the spatula to ensure uniform baking.
- Bake: Place the pan in the preheated oven and bake for approximately 60 minutes. Test for doneness by inserting a toothpick into the center; it should come out clean when the bread is fully baked.
- Cool: Remove the loaf from the oven and let it cool in the pan for about 10 minutes. Then transfer it to a wire rack to cool completely before slicing and serving.
Notes
- Do not overmix the batter to maintain a tender crumb.
- You can add nuts or chocolate chips for extra texture and flavor.
- Store the pumpkin bread in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days or refrigerate for up to a week.
- For a gluten-free version, substitute all-purpose flour with a gluten-free flour blend.
- Ensure canned pumpkin puree is 100% pumpkin, not pumpkin pie filling, to avoid excess sugar and spices.
